Job DescriptionScope of Position The Distribution Department is responsible for the order, receipt, storage, and distribution of Medical Center supplies, linens, and portable equipment throughout the Medical Center. The department has the responsibility for overseeing the operation of the Automated Guided Vehicle System, which moves all supplies, food, and trash within the Medical Center. The department is also responsible for maintaining Inventory Management Systems throughout the Medical Center. Distribution is responsible for triage and reprocessing of portable equipment. The department coordinates Specialty Bed placements and charge capture for beds and equipment. The department enforces sound materials management practices throughout the Medical Center. Position Summary Provide centralized control and distribution of portable medical equipment throughout the Medical Center. Inspect and check portable equipment; troubleshoot minor equipment problems. May assist Stores Clerks in filling storeroom, linen, and portable equipment orders. Receives and unloads stock. Monitors and maintains adequate supply inventory and maintain related records and documentation. Serves as a liaison between Medical Center departments, patient care staff, Materiel Systems, and vendors. Maintains proficiency in the PeopleSoft eMaterials system.
